What to Expect at Your First Visit

Your Comfort is Our Priority

Your first appointment at our Washington, DC dental office typically includes a full exam, necessary digital X-rays, and a consultation to discuss your oral health and treatment goals. In most cases, we’re also able to perform a professional dental cleaning during this initial visit.
Some patients with complex health histories or treatment needs may require a separate visit to complete recommended services. But rest assured—we’ll take the time to answer all your questions and create a care plan that works for you.

Please Bring the Following to Your Appointment:

  • Any recent or past dental X-rays (or let us know where we can request them)
  • A list of all current medications
  • If applicable, your medical or dental insurance subscriber info or forms


If you are under the age of 18, you must be accompanied by a parent or legal guardian at your first visit.Also, please alert us ahead of time if you have any medical conditions that might affect treatment, such as:

  • Diabetes
  • High blood pressure
  • Artificial joints or heart valves
  • Rheumatic fever
  • Anticoagulant use or aspirin therapy


Our team is committed to your safety, and we’ll work with you to ensure all necessary precautions are taken.

Transferring or Taking X-Rays

If another provider has taken recent dental X-rays, we encourage you to have them forwarded to our office prior to your visit. If that’s not possible, you may bring them with you. If additional imaging is needed, we’re happy to take high-quality digital X-rays here in our office for enhanced diagnosis and treatment planning.
